At the top of the document is the name of the appellate or trial court where the case is pending, Below the court name is the case caption, which names the parties in the lawsuit, provides the case number, and lists the charges involved, Following the caption is a narrative, which is almost always numbered paragraphs that are intended to describe the criminal offense with more specificity. A speaking indictment is a term used to refer to an indictment that includes more information than what is required by the law. Probable cause falls below the preponderance of the evidence standard, which is a greater than 50% chance that someone did something.
